LG must feel like its shouting into the wind when it comes to its smartphones.
The company today showed off the Optimus G, the latest Android super smartphone. The smartphone boasts the most advanced Qualcomm Snapdragon quad-core processor, a 13-megapixel camera, and a hefty 2,100mAh battery.
The question is: will anyone care?
